- The distance between Quintero, Chile and Kumasi, Ghana is approximately 8,571 km or 5,326 mi.
- To reach Quintero in this distance one would set out from Kumasi bearing 233.8°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Quintero bearing 253° or WSW .
- Quintero is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Kumasi is in or near the tropical dry for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 12.8 °C (23°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 3 °C (5.4°F) more in Quintero.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1143 mm (45 in) less which is equivalent to 1143 l/m² (28.05 US gal/ft²) or 11,430,000 l/ha (1,221,943 US gal/ac) less. About 2/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 18° lower in Quintero than in Kumasi.
- Relative humidity levels are 3.7%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 11.9°C (21.4°F) lower.
